Hemp Wood

Hemp Wood is an innovative, sustainable material created by compressing hemp fibers into dense, durable planks that serve as an alternative to traditional timber. The material is lauded for its environmental benefits, including a rapid growth cycle and carbon sequestration properties.

Production and Composition

The process for creating Hemp Wood involves several key stages:

  1. Harvesting: Industrial hemp is harvested.
  2. Fiber Preparation: The stalks are separated, and the fibrous material is broken down.
  3. Binding: The hemp fibers are bound together using a soy-based, food-grade adhesive.
  4. Compression: The material is subjected to high heat and extreme pressure to form solid, wood-like blocks.
  5. Curing and Milling: The blocks are cured and then milled into various dimensions, such as planks for flooring, lumber, or panels.

This production method results in a material that is often denser and harder than oak, providing a high level of durability.

Uses and Applications

Hemp Wood can be utilized in almost any application where traditional hardwood is used.

Environmental Impact

Hemp Wood is considered an environmentally superior choice to many traditional hardwoods due to:

  • Rapid Growth: Hemp is ready for harvest in approximately 120 days, whereas hardwood trees can take decades.
  • Carbon Sequestration: Hemp plants absorb a significant amount of CO2 during their growth, locking the carbon into the finished product.
  • Adhesive: The use of a non-toxic, soy-based adhesive avoids the harmful chemicals often found in composite wood products.
